Jordan Public School District holds organizational meeting; board re‑elects officers, approves personnel and pay‑equity updates
Summary
At its organizational meeting, the Jordan Public School District board of education held a ceremonial oath, elected officers by acclamation, approved routine organizational items and personnel contracts, and deferred any change to board compensation after a brief discussion of pay equity and budget timing.
Board members of the Jordan Public School District recited the ceremonial oath of office and then opened the district's organizational and regular meeting.
In an otherwise procedural session, the board elected officers, confirmed routine financial and administrative authorities, approved a substitute principal arrangement and pay‑equity contract adjustments, and approved a set of personnel items after two members abstained because of a conflict.
The organizational items set routine authorities and dates the board uses for the year, while the personnel approvals and contract adjustments implement pay‑equity changes required by the state.
The board elected Deb Polly as chair by acclamation and named Molly Moniak vice chair, Lauren Pederson clerk and Corinne Hennen treasurer. The board approved a treasurer's bond for $100,000 in Corinne Hennen's name, designated depositories (Franzen Bank, Riverland Bank, MSBA Liquid Asset Fund, Hometown Bank and Minnesota Trust), and named the Henderson Independent as the district newspaper for legal notices.
